I normally have good things to say about everywhere I have gone so I will start with that for here. The service was good, everyone was kind and food was done in a timely manner for me to pick up. But.....the sauce for the gyoza was so watered down it had no flavor and the gyoza had like a bleachey taste to them. I ordered the pork stir-fry and it was okay nothing great or anything. Lots of veggies but the mini corns had a weird tingey flavor. I ended up just throwing it all away cause I couldn't bring myself to finish. I am a bit shocked at the quality of food,quantity is great if you need a lot to fill your tummy. I will not choose to eat there again considering a 7 piece gyoza and the pork stir-fry cost me almost 25 dollars and it ended up in the trash.
